Contracts
Distribution
Bridge
Website
Electra Protocol Blockchain, Multi Layer Explorer
Search
Supply:
18,325,808,073
Lastest Block:
1,964,169
Utxos:
1,983,827
Nodes:
346
OmniXEP Contracts:
274
Block detail
[STAKE]
02/07/2024 19:58:24 UTC
Txid
e1bb7087f3928d2025270b1a11ec0af88d88027574a0dd9b3fcc6e6f20003068
Block
1,386,852
Block hash
18a3640b3379afcd60773c6d04364dfd60ae94a80c6d75d4ec5cc987fbb7732c
Stake amount
67.6392674 XEP
Sender
ep1qmck3ecy6m5w3rsuq739yhwnqxhrakh05eddl20
Recipient
ep1qmck3ecy6m5w3rsuq739yhwnqxhrakh05eddl20
(644,445.5955867 XEP)